Highlights
  • Rong Kueak Shrine - Explore the local community and old Chinese shrine and make an offering to the deity to wish for good health and protection
  • Chinatown - Bangkok - Enter the Dragon and soak in the vibrant atmosphere of the street markets, where it is said, you can find just about anything!
  • Pak Khlong Talat (Flower Market) - Explore the biggest fresh flower market in Bangkok which is overflowing with dazzling fauna from across Thailand.
  • Chao Phraya River - Cycle across the River of Kings, the lifeblood of Bangkok, and enjoy the unfolding views of the beautiful riverside landmarks
  • Wat Prayurawongsawat Worawihan - Take some time out in the old Portuguese community, relax in the cool shade of the temple grounds and feed the hungry turtles!
  • Wat Kalayanamit Varamahavihara - Discover the beautiful culture of Thailand and make an offering for the largest seated Buddha image in Bangkok.

Great way to see the less commercial side of Bangkok with an excellent guide- markets, temples & river views! - My family of 5 (3 teenagers) really enjoyed our half-day guided cycle ride round the back streets of Bangkok. We cycled through narrow alleys and residential areas, visited a couple of Buddhist temples, stopped a few times in market areas, sampled Thai sweet snacks & enjoyed a cold drink near Santa Cruz church in the Portuguese area. We all agreed it was a great experience made memorable by our guide Mai who answered our numerous questions. Please note, We are all cyclists which helped- inexperienced visitors may find the narrow alleys a challenge as well as getting your bike in & off the ferry.
